Turn your iOS device into a digital depth finder. Great Depths offers coverage of the entire US coast, the Great Lakes, Lake Champlain and more... Know exactly where you are on the water and cruise to your port of call directly and safely. Sail with Great Depths for iPhone and iPad.
Great Depths offers digital depth readouts, live tide data and NOAA RNC nautical charts in 60 bargain-priced packages. Digital depth readouts are automatically adjusted based on current tide/lake level and are updated as you move or viewed anywhere with the touch of a finger.
-- The handy mileage menu calculates distance between any two points instantly.
-- Purchases are automatically synced across all your iOS devices and downloaded packages are stored locally on your devices so you don’t have to rely on cell service.
-- Best of all, Great Depths is FREE and never has adds! You can download the app and preview the available charts packages without spending a dime.
Chart coverage includes the entire coast of the contiguous USA, the Great Lakes, Lake Champlain, the Erie, Oswego and Champlain Canals, Lake Mead, Lake Oswego, Lake Pend Oreille, Lake Okeechobee, Lake Winnebago, Franklin D. Roosevelt Lake, Lake Cayuga, Lake Seneca Lakes, Wake Island and more....
